The Innovation Essentials for Business Leaders Open Course from Saïd Business School, University of Oxford begins with the idea that innovation is about creatively combining existing and new elements to serve new purposes, often in unfamiliar contexts. It focuses on how to lead organisations that both optimise current resources and explore future opportunities. You’ll explore key questions such as what innovation truly means, why it matters, and how leaders can embed innovation into everyday practice. Two core principles underpin this approach: technology is just one starting point for successful innovation, and its impact depends on the organisation’s capabilities and capacity. The course opens by breaking down and defining the concept of innovation.
